^Hallway on the 4th floor is currently serving as a paint sampling area. The long wall facing the windows will be a different color on each of the 7 floors, with a light gray along the wall with the windows. The chosen colors were inspired by the French artist
FERNAND LEGER who had a great influence on the development of Cubism and
Constructivism.
His own words describe the color scheme planned for the dorm hallways:
"I organize the opposition between colors, lines and curves.
I set curves against straight lines, patches of color against plastic forms,
pure colors against subtly nuanced shades of gray."
